Rick Walton on Picture Books (3:48) Picture books aren’t just for young children – they are for everyone. Our guest today, author and educator, Margaret Blair Young talks about the universal appeal of picture books and shares the thoughts of late author, Rick Walton on this subject. Young's published works include the novels House Without Walls, Salvador, and Heresies of Nature. She also co-authored a trilogy of historical novels about Black Mormon pioneers titled Standing on the Promises with Darius Gray. She is currently at work on a feature film, Heart of Africa. Social and Emotional Skills (16:27) Next, Rachel visits with Lynnette Christensen, professor in the BYU School of Education, about critical skills that children need to develop: social and emotional tools that they will use all their lives when interacting with others.
